The high accuracy and stable timing synchronized system is widely applied at present, our company develops high accuracy PCI-E timing card for providing unified system timing to military and high-accuracy civil. PCI-E not only adopts high performance GNSS mode as the time source,but also the B code . It shows that this timing card operates stable ,develops the computer system time accuracy obviously after testing.
